#pragma once
// layer includes
#ifdef WIN32
// undefined clashing windows #defines
#undef CreateEvent
#undef CreateSemaphore
#endif
#include <vk_layer.h>
void InitReplayTables(void *vulkanModule);
void InitInstanceReplayTables(VkInstance instance);
void InitDeviceReplayTables(VkDevice device);
VkLayerDispatchTable *GetDeviceDispatchTable(void *device);
VkLayerInstanceDispatchTable *GetInstanceDispatchTable(void *instance);
class WrappedVulkan;
template<typename parenttype, typename wrappedtype>
void SetDispatchTable(bool writing, parenttype parent, WrappedVulkan *core, wrappedtype *wrapped)
{
wrapped->core = core;
if(writing)
{
wrapped->table = wrappedtype::UseInstanceDispatchTable
? (uintptr_t)GetInstanceDispatchTable((void *)parent)
: (uintptr_t)GetDeviceDispatchTable((void *)parent);
}
else
{
wrapped->table = wrappedtype::UseInstanceDispatchTable
? (uintptr_t)GetInstanceDispatchTable(NULL)
: (uintptr_t)GetDeviceDispatchTable(NULL);
}
}
